David Archuleta has had an incredible run on American Idol, cruising through every round without threat of being voted off. He seems to have won the hearts of judges and the public.
However, Archuleta’s talent and success has been marred by his dad, Jeff, who has been a tiresome presence to contestants, producers and vocal coaches throughout the entire series. This only became public this week, when Jeff insisted that David replace some of the lyrics of his first song “Stand by Me” with a verse from Sean Kingston’s “Beautiful Girls”. Although the producers refused permission, the lyrics were changed in David’s performance.
This caused a major stir with the song’s publishers, and American Idol had to pay up. The show’s lawyers then told Jeff that he could sit in the live audience, but he was banned from going backstage. As David is now 17, it was ruled that he doesn’t need a guardian, only a ‘teacher’. Jeff Archuleta was also banned from the set of “Star Search”, in which David competed a few years back.
Parents on reality TV: Do they make or break their children?
Pushy and deranged parents have been behind star children from Michael Jackson to Lindsay Lohan. There is a fine line between providing opportunities for a child to nurture a talent and achieve their potential, and pushing a child to emotional breaking point and creating a lot of embarrassment along the way.
Simon Cowell has often criticised parents for instilling their children with false confidence about the extent of their talents, telling the parents of an atrociously bad singer on X-Factor “You are the reason why this girl is disappointed and I have to blame you guys for encouraging her to believe she’s going to do well in something when she so obviously isn’t. You have given her false hope.”
